#76c1d0 basic color information

#76c1d0

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#76c1d0 has decimal index of: 7782864, is composed of 46.3% red, 75.7% green and 81.6% blue. #76c1d0 in CMYK color model, is composed of 43.3% cyan, 7.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black.
#66cccc is the closest web-safe color to #76c1d0.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
